sentry-provider/sentry-provider-db/src/main/java/org/apache/sentry/provider/db/service/persistent/DeltaTransactionBlock.java Lines 87 (patched) <https://reviews.apache.org/r/58281/#comment244381> Is it possible for the following scenario to happen? There are two Sentry server instances running. Request A goes to Sentry A, and add a perm update. At the same time HMSFollower at Sentry B gets a path update. Both Sentry A and Sentry B calls this function to persist update. And both get lastChangeID to be, for example, 3. If Sentry A calls "pm.makePersistent" first, the "SentryStore.getLastProcessedChangeIDCore" is 4 now.
